โœฆ Synopsis


David Moore and William Notz's Statistics: Concepts and Controversies (SCC) introduces liberal arts majors to statistical ideas--and shows them how use those ideas to think about the statistical claims they see every day from polls, campaigns, advertising, public policy, and many different fields of study. The ultimate goal is to equip students with solid statistical reasoning skills that will help them understand impact of statistics on all aspects of our lives.The new edition offers SCC's signature combination of engaging cases, real-life examples and exercises, helpful pedagogy, rich full-color design, and innovative media learning tools, all significantly updated.
